Raisbeck raises bar with new director
Experienced sales and purchasing man Nick Lyle has joined Raisbeck Engineering as director of sales.
Raisbeck Engineering sales director Nick Lyle.

Raisbeck Engineering has appointed Nick Lyle as director of sales. He will be responsible for overseeing the company's sales initiatives, dealer support, onsite dealer technical and sales training and contributing to the company's overall strategic direction.

In a move to strengthen Raisbeck's steadily growing sales and worldwide dealer support network, Lyle comes to Raisbeck with a strong background in MRO sales, modification and avionics sales, spares sales, and an extensive product knowledge and commitment to providing quality service.

“We are thrilled to welcome Nick to Raisbeck Engineering,” says president Lynn Thomas. “He is an excellent fit for our sales team, well-respected and well-connected in the industry, and I am confident his passion for the business and experience will have a positive impact on the growth of the company. The experience he has gained in past leadership roles and natural ability to develop long lasting relationships within the aviation industry will prove invaluable to our dealers and business associates at Raisbeck.”

Lyle has almost 14 years of sales and purchasing experience gained in the execution of selling aircraft modifications and aircraft spares for domestic and international customers. He joins Raisbeck from Commuter Air Technology where he was senior manager of MRO sales, responsible for developing and improving new business relationships for aircraft modifications and aircraft spares programmes. He also led STC and MRO sales and was instrumental in their expanded growth.

Previously he worked in multiple sales and purchasing roles for Jet Service Enterprises and Ray Albright Steel Products, where he honed his skill set for negotiating price and contract terms for major purchases and programmes.
